
在移动端部署TP(TokenPocket)安卓钱包和通用Web3钱包时,如何构建便捷支付服务与可靠的交易验证体系,是每个开发者和产品经理必须掌握的技能。本文采用循序教程风格,从架构选择到运营落地,提供可实操的要点和专业判断,帮助你把产品打造成全球化智能支付平台。
第一步,明确钱包定位和架构。非托管钱包侧重私钥安全(Android Keystore、TEE、MPC、硬件签名),托管或混合方案则需考虑KYC/合规与密钥管理。选用WalletConnect、DeepLink和SDK来实现与DApp的无缝打通,兼顾用户体验与权限控制。
第二步,实现便捷支付服务。设计“一键支付+代付”流程,优化gas策略(Layer2、批量交易、gasless meta-transactions),并接入法币通道与稳定币网关。采用支付聚合层和异步回调保证高并发下的支付成功率与可追溯性,前端在安卓端应弱化签名复杂度、加强提示与回滚机制,降低用户流失。

第三步,结合BaaS与信息化趋势。利用BaaS服务快速获得节点、合约托管、身份与审计能力,将上链复杂性下沉为可调用的API。信息化方向包括链下数据中台、事件总线、BI与风控仪表盘,支持实时告警与策略回滚,形成闭环运营能力。
第四步,交易验证与安全设计。实现多层验证:签名校验、Merkle/SPV证明、链上回执确认、前向/回放保护;结合链上观测器、链下验证器与机器学习欺诈检测,及时拦截异常交易。安卓端强化Keystore隔离、代码混淆、完整性校验与安全更新机制。
第五步,打造全球化智能支付平台。重视区域合规、结算对接、本地化通道和汇率处理;采用容器化、多活部署、CDN与边缘缓存保障低延迟。开放API与SDK生态,配合合作伙伴的BaaS能力,实现从钱包到支付的产品闭环。
最后,专业研判与落地建议。未来趋势向隐私保护、跨链互操作、Layer2扩展与合规托管化发展。前瞻性投入MPC、零知识证明与可审计治理,将在安全与体验间找到平衡。落地时强调可观测性、应急恢复与合规流程,才能把技术能力转化为可持续商业价值。
评论
链工小陈
实用性很强,BaaS部分尤其受用。
CryptoAnna
讲解清晰,想知道更多关于MPC的实现细节。
李想
希望看到实际代码示例和接入流程。
DevTom
对跨链和gas优化的建议很实在。